What Is Airvoice Wireless?

Airvoice Wireless is a prepaid mobile service provider that operates as a Mobile Virtual Network Operator (MVNO). Instead of building its own network infrastructure, Airvoice uses the towers of a major U.S. carrier primarily AT&T.

This allows Airvoice to provide:

  • Affordable prepaid plans
  • No contracts or long-term commitments
  • Flexible options for individuals and families
  • Reliable nationwide coverage

Because it runs on AT&T’s network, your phone must be compatible with that network’s technology and frequency bands.

Airvoice Wireless Compatible Phones

What Phones Are Compatible with Airvoice Wireless?

Airvoice Wireless supports a wide range of smartphones, but they must meet certain criteria.

1. Unlocked Phones

Your phone must be unlocked, meaning it is not restricted to a specific carrier. Locked phones from Verizon, T-Mobile, or other providers may not work unless they are officially unlocked.

2. GSM-Compatible Devices

Airvoice operates on a GSM network, so your phone must support GSM technology. Most modern smartphones are GSM-compatible, but some older devices especially CDMA-only phones will not work.

3. AT&T Network Compatibility

Since Airvoice uses AT&T towers, your phone must support AT&T frequency bands. Devices designed for AT&T typically work best, but many unlocked phones from other carriers are also compatible.

Key Requirements for Compatibility

To ensure your phone works perfectly with Airvoice Wireless, it must meet these essential requirements:

1. Unlocked Status

Your phone must not be tied to any carrier. If it is locked, request an unlock from your current provider before switching.

2. LTE or 5G Support

Airvoice requires phones that support 4G LTE or 5G. Older 3G-only devices are no longer supported due to network shutdowns.

3. Correct Network Bands

Your phone should support AT&T-compatible bands, especially:

  • LTE bands commonly used in the U.S.
  • GSM frequencies such as 850 MHz and 1900 MHz

4. SIM or eSIM Compatibility

Most devices use a nano SIM card, while newer phones may support eSIM activation. Either option works with Airvoice, depending on your device.

How to Check If Your Phone Is Compatible

Before activating your service, it’s important to verify compatibility.

Step-by-Step Process:

  1. Dial *#06# on your phone to find your IMEI number
  2. Visit the Airvoice Wireless compatibility checker
  3. Enter your IMEI number
  4. Review the results

This is the most reliable way to confirm whether your device will work.

Phones You Should Avoid

Certain types of phones are not suitable for Airvoice Wireless:

  • Carrier-locked devices that haven’t been unlocked
  • CDMA-only phones (commonly older Verizon or Sprint devices)
  • 3G-only smartphones that lack LTE support
  • Outdated devices missing required network bands

Using these phones can result in poor performance or no service at all.
